I'm trying to locate the valve for the water supply from the thru
hull fitting to the A/C unit. The manual says that it should be right
by the unit but I sure cant find it. As always I appreciate any and all help from you guys.

The thru hull fitting comes up through the hull in front of the port engine and the shut off valve is located on top of it. The water then passes through the brass sea strainer and into the pump mounted on the fire wall. Then the hose goes up the port side of the boat to the A/C unit mounted under the berth. Then it exits out a fitting on the starboard side.
